Dale Earnhardt Jr. once used a questionable pass below the yellow line to beat Matt Kenseth at Talladega. Looking back at that 2003 victory, Earnhardt can't figure out what he did differently than Regan Smith did last week at the same track. Smith's last-lap pass of Tony Stewart was below the out-of-bounds line and ruled illegal, which denied Smith his first victory. "It was exactly the same. I was...

Dale Earnhardt Jr. had better days at Talladega. Earnhardt's No. 88 Chevrolet blew an engine in the first practice Friday and blew a tire in the second and it cost him any shot of starting in the front of the field. When the right tire exploded in the afternoon practice, it triggered a multicar wreck that affected Tony Stewart, Kasey Kahne, David Reutimann and a few others. Earnhardt spun and hit the...
